Output 834dd50ad8230c1a4fb3b27f8272ae53a75c71eb2a44913c9e0f83a6a6ee4898:0

value
13669449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59900553cfe01e56ade3cb79f5b6e19e96d40d0f OP_EQUAL
address
39rabMiVWSoe8YoG1DgLBkEUVA1HnJf6uA
transaction
834dd50ad8230c1a4fb3b27f8272ae53a75c71eb2a44913c9e0f83a6a6ee4898
spent
true